Chrome 80 将支持 SVG favicon 图标

出现在网站页面标题左侧的微小图标,行业内称为 favicon 或网站图标,Google Chrome 从 80 版本起将开始支持 favicon 的 SVG 图像格式,目前的金丝雀每日测试版本已经包含该特性,而 Firefox 支持它已经有 4 年了。

Google 在 Chrome 中添加对 favicon 的 SVG 支持并不容易,因为 Chromium 员工在相关的 bug 报告帖子中表示这难以实施,这是因为 Chrome 的 SVG 代码已高度集成到核心渲染引擎中,因此,这需要调整整个渲染器。

Chrome 80将支持SVG favicon图标
Chrome 80将支持SVG favicon图标

相比之下,微软的 Internet Explorer 和 Edge 尚不支持 SVG 图标,Firefox 目前是唯一支持该图标的浏览器,Chrome 的跟进意味着其他基于 Chromium 的浏览器(如 Vivaldi,Opera,Brave 和新版 Microsoft Edge)也会同时支持 SVG 作为 favicon。

现在,您可以使用 “ prefers-color-scheme” 来设置 SVG 图标的样式,为了外观上能够与主题统一,Chrome 还会在启用黑暗模式时将图标显示为黑色,而在浅色模式下将图标显示为黄色。

要测试浏览器是否支持 SVG 网站图标,请在浏览器地址栏中访问该测试站点,如果您在选项卡中或在网站图标的位置看到笑脸,那么浏览器支持该功能(如果您看到悲伤的笑脸),如若没有图标则说明该浏览器不支持该功能。

Chrome 80将支持SVG favicon图标
(0)
techant的头像techant

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注